Top 20 Superfoods For Weight Loss

We all know the foundations for successful weight loss are having a healthy diet and doing exercises frequently. Many people fail to lose weight, despite their long and hard efforts in the gym. Therefore, if you want to boost your weight loss speed, check out these 20 secret-weapon foods which are shown to be useful for obese people.


1. Apples


Apples are known as a natural weight-loss food. They contain fiber, minerals and lots of vitamins. Especially, this fruit type is low in calories, low in fat as well as sodium. Thus, apples can help you lose weight in different ways. The fiber helps expand in your stomach; therefore, you will need less food to satisfy your hunger. Apples are a low-sodium food that helps prevent excess water weight or retention. Lastly, your health and vitality are increased significantly thanks to vitamins found in apples.

2. Kiwis

Kiwis carry a lot of nutrition in a small package. They are low in calories and also packed with plenty of fiber. Nutritionists show that foods, which contain a great deal of fiber, can reduce high cholesterol levels. Consequently, these food types including Kiwis may reduce the risk of heart attack and heart disease. Fiber is also good for filling you up and suppressing your appetite- a great advantage for those wanting to lose weight.

3. Blueberries

Blueberries are a magical food helping people control their weight effectively. The reason is that they are low in sugar; have no fat and are free with cholesterol. In addition, they are high in fiber which will help to fill you up, while not providing you a lot of calories. To eat 100 calories worth of blueberries you would need to have 1 ¼ cup of blueberries.

4. Pomegranates


Pomegranates are extremely nutritious and their high fiber content can help control blood-sugar levels. One cup of pomegranate contains about 150 calories. This type of fruit is rich in vitamin K, vitamin C, potassium and folate. However, dietitians suggest that you should not just drink the juice; eat them for their biggest weight-loss benefits. In addition to doing exercises frequently and having a healthy diet, adding pomegranate to your diet will surely help you lose the pounds easier as it is packed with antioxidants and polyphenols, all of which help you burn fat and boost your metabolism.

5. Pears

Pears are the great source of fiber, which can help regulate your digestive system. This type of fruit is a magic food for weight loss since their pectin promotes fullness, helps control your cravings. At only about 100 calories per pear, this juicy, sweet fruit is great as a stand-alone snack, with a meal, or pureed into dessert.

6. Quinces

Related to apples and pears, quinces are a golden yellow, broad pome fruit loaded with vitamin C, antioxidants, dietary fiber, copper, and pectin, which helps control the digestion and improving your blood sugar level. Quinces have a sour flavor; thus, you won’t want to eat these right off the tree. Try them in jams and jellies, or dice half of one into a homemade apple pie to enhance its flavor.

7. Bok Choys

One cup of cooked bok choy provides only 20 calories. According to nutritionists, it’s loaded with fiber and rich in vitamin A, potassium, calcium and beta-carotene. It has a particularly large water content, which can help you feel full and lose even more weight.

8. Runner Beans

These protein-rich beans are low in fat and high in fiber. One of the disadvantages of low-calorie diets is that it makes you feel constantly hungry. When we eat protein-rich foods like beans, we’ll feel fuller; therefore, smaller portions are likely to be taken. An important note needs to be mentioned here is that runner beans should not be eaten raw because they contain a chemical called lectin phytohemagglutinin, a toxin that has bad effects on the red cells in your blood. Be sure to cook them thoroughly before eating.

9. Pumpkins

Pumpkin is not only a super healthy treat, but it’s also one of the greatest weight-loss foods around. It is not high in calorie level, but full of vitamins, fiber, and minerals. Pumpkin is also an excellent source of the important antioxidant beta-carotene. Enjoy it fresh or canned—you’ll still get the same nutritional benefits.


Yams are packed with antioxidants (like carotenoids), vitamins and minerals. They are quite low on the glycemic scale, meaning you’ll digest them slower and stay full longer. Moreover, nutritionally-dense yams in your diet can trigger the satiety center in the brain quickly, make you feel full faster. If you want to lose some pounds, yams should be included in your diet.

11. Kales

Kale along with broccoli, it is one of the nutrition stand-outs among vegetables. For a green, kale is unusually high in fiber. This helps create the bulk you need to fill you up and to keep you full for a good amount of time. Kale is also an excellent source of nutrients, especially vitamin A and calcium. With a combination of vitamins, minerals, and phytonutrients, kale is a dieter’s dream food.

12. Lentils

Lentils are full with fiber, which is crucial to satisfying your hunger and reducing your appetite. This food is rich in soluble fiber, which also lowers blood cholesterol. Not only that, but because they boast a bevy of nutrients, lentils are finally gaining the recognition they deserve as a great source of low-fat protein, making them the perfect substitute for meat.

13. Parsnips

Like other types of vegetables, cooked parsnips contain approximately 3 grams of fiber per half cup to help you stay full and satisfied. Parsnips are considered as starchy vegetables, so it is recommended to be eaten in place of rice, bread or other starchy foods.

14. Cauliflowers

Cauliflower is fat free, rich in vitamin C and can pass for a low-carb version of mashed potatoes with ease. Its strong flavor allows it to stand alone without any consumption of meat or other fatty foods. And if you’re really hungry, raw cauliflower will serve you as a wonderful snack. Because it’s extra crunchy, cauliflower takes longer to chew, giving your body time to realize you’re really full.

15. Oats

Like other food types, oats are a superfood to help lose weight, as they are a great source of fiber. Oatmeal is one of the greatest foods for breakfast because it boosts your energy and has lots of fiber to give you feelings of being full and satisfied. Oatmeal breaks down slowly in the stomach, giving you long-lasting energy. It is also full of water-soluble fibers, which play a crucial role in making you feel full over a longer period of time. Studies have shown that oatmeal lowers cholesterol level, stabilizes blood sugar level and fights against heart disease, colon cancer, diabetes and obesity.

16. Buckwheat

Buckwheat lowers the risk of high blood pressure. This food is high in phytochemicals which protect against diseases by acting as antioxidants. Eating foods high in fiber, such as buckwheat, can also fill you up faster and suppress your appetite, a great tool for weight loss.

17. Garlic

Garlic is rich in the compound allicin, which has anti-bacterial effects and helps remove unhealthy fats and cholesterol. This food acts as a natural appetite suppressant in several ways. Garlic has a strong odor which stimulates the satiety center in the brain. Thus, you feel less hungry and automatically eat at smaller amount of foods. Besides, its odor helps increase the brain’s sensitivity to leptin (a hormone that helps regulate appetite).

18. Eggs

Eggs are a good source of vitamins, proteins and minerals. As said by nutrition experts, eggs are not only a great source of nutrition, but also very useful to help lose weight. When combining eggs with other dishes you will limit the consumption of complex carbohydrates in the body. Your hunger and food cravings will occur less frequent. Egg itself is sufficient in helping in weight loss. It is strongly recommended to consume eggs for breakfast as it provides maximum advantages for weight loss. The more eggs that are consumed during breakfast time, the more lean muscle mass that is maintained. This is important for long term weight loss and its maintenance.

19. Wild Salmons

Wild salmon is full with omega-3 fatty acids. Some dieters try to avoid any type of fat and believe that it will make them gain weight. This is completely wrong. By contrast, one particular type of fat, omega-3 fatty acid, is very good for your health. Omega-3 fatty acids actually promote weight loss in several ways. They help stabilize the insulin in your body and decrease insulin resistance. They improve blood sugar control, which helps reduce food cravings and overeating. Omega-3s help your body to burn off calories before they get stored as fat.

20. Sardines

Sardines are a wonderful food for anyone wanting to lose weight. Firstly, sardines are packed with protein, which helps control blood sugar at stable level, makes you feel full and helps stimulate metabolism. Second, they’re also a great source of omega-3s, which not only support the cardiovascular system but also are helpful in boosting mood. (When people are in a good mood, they have the tendency to crave less junk food.) 

Chris Jacken used to work as a doctor of a general hospital in February 1998. Currently, Chris is a writer specializing in weight loss related issues. He posts his articles on a number of different directories.

Category: Weight Loss
